22 Div Soldiers Contribute to 'Diabetes Walk'

Around 60 Army personnel of the 22 Division Headquarters, including woman soldiers of the 5 (V) Sri Lanka Army Women's Corps (SLAWC) and 221 Brigade actively contributed to the successful conduct of the recent 'Diabetes Walk' of the 'Let's Defeat Diabetes' project of the Sri Lanka Diabetes Federation and the 306 Lions Club.

Those troops when the 'Diabetes Walk' began from Trincomalee Hindu Cultural Centre ground joined the walk, launched to create Diabetes awareness among the general public. The event also assisted the general public to learn more about this preventable disease which claims thousands of lives every year.

Lions Club project chairperson Lion Wasantha Gamage has requested Major General Aruna Jayasekara, General Officer Commanding, 22 Division for participation of Army personnel in the walk when it inaugurates in Trincomalee.

At the launch of the 'Diabetes Walk', religious dignitaries, Major General Aruna Jayasekara, General Officer Commanding, 22 Division, Mr Nimal Perera, DIG Trincomalee, Mr S Arul Rasa, Additional District Secretary, Lions District Governor Rupa Dheerasinghe, Dr Prasad Katulanda, Chairperson, Sri Lanka Diabetes Federation, several Senior Army and Police Officers and a gathering of about 250 civilians participated in the inauguration of the walk.
